Changing Attribute Measures for Surface Area and Volume Review • Cylinder • When you double height, double volume (multiply by 2) • When halving height, half volume (divide by 2) • Prism • When doubling length, width or height, double volume (multiply by 2) • When halving length, width or height, half volume (divide by 2) • When you double all 3 measurements, multiply the volume by 8 • When halving all 3 measurements, divide the volume by 8 • When you double all 3 measurements, multiply the surface area by 4. • When halving all 3 measurements, divide the surface area by 4.
